The primary objective of the Shelter & Settlement Manager role is to oversee Shelter, NFI, and construction activities in Borno State for DRC. In collaboration with other sector managers, the manager will be responsible for conducting assessments of shelter and infrastructure needs in various IDPs camps, identifying vulnerable households eligible for upgraded emergency shelters, and pinpointing infrastructure needs in these camps. Additionally, the role involves the creation of suitable designs, Bills of Quantities (BoQs), budgets, and Procurement Plans.

The Shelter & Settlement Manager will lead and manage the construction of emergency, transitional and permanent shelters, as well as infrastructure projects, ensuring adherence to camp layouts or implementing necessary updates. Moreover, the Shelter & Settlement Manager will work closely with the DRC WASH, camp management, and protection units to ensure that Infrastructure, shelter, and NFI program activities are carried out in conjunction, addressing basic protection concerns comprehensively. The technical line management for this position is under the country WASH & Shelter Coordinator.

Shelter &Settlement Program implementation:
  • Overall responsible of shelter and all construction works in Borno state
  • Develop a work plan for construction activities and ensure progress and quality in line with applicable international standards and agreements.
Construction activities will include, but not be limited to:
  • large-scale construction of family shelters for IDPs/refugees (both emergency and semi-permanent shelters);
  • Construction of communal infrastructure (including both traditional structures using local materials and semi-permanent, mud-brick buildings).
  • Construction of buildings to support other projects, such as classrooms and training centers
  • Involve IDP/refugee community in all stages of construction activities, from planning to implementation and evaluation;
  • Provide technical support to refugees who can construct own shelter, and organize work teams to construct shelter for vulnerable families;
  • Supervision of contractors and suppliers, ensuring that deliveries take place according to the quantity and quality agreed;
  • Ensure quality supervision of quality of work of any contractors hired for construction activities at all stages of the construction process.
  • Ensure that all documentation related to shelter activities for works completed, laborer engaged and supplies is completed in a timely manner;
  • Develop/update maps of the camp as necessary in coordination with site planning officer  – UNHCR/IOM
  • Adapt construction activities, as applicable, in close coordination with Area Manager, if/as the context changes; In particular, the shelter manager may be required to significantly scale up construction activities in case of a large IDP/refugee influx and/or redeploy staffing and resources to new camp sites in case of a major influx;
  • Any other tasks assigned by the Area Manager to support general camp management operations;
  • Other tasks related to infrastructure/construction supervision may also occur.
